As time has gone I've learned to recognize the signs to expect for pregnant sheep. And my ewes are exhibiting ALL of them.
1) Increased size (especially obvious when they are walking away from you or laying down)
2) Their udders form (my ewes don't have full bags yet, but I can tell that they are beginning to form udders, which is a good sign considering how far out they are)
3) They just act strange (my ewes are a bit more skittish around me as their pregnancies have progressed)
4) The female parts on the backside turn pink, widen, and become floppy (my ewes started exhibiting this about two weeks ago)

How soon do you start counting once you expose them to the ram?? Trying to see when I should expect babies.
@homesteadingwithPJ
@homesteadingwithPJ Жыл бұрын
I find that a ram should have 6 weeks with ewes. AndI find that usually 5 months after I remove the ram is when I can expect sheep. They usually don't breed immediately. At least, mine don't. I've heard the really big operations will move rams really far away from the ewes all year, and then put in a weather (casterated ram) to get the ewes to all "cycle up" at the same time. Then throw in the stud rams.
